Infosys Limited is an Indian multinational information technology company that provides business consulting, information technology and outsourcing services. Founded in Pune and headquartered in Bengaluru, Infosys is the second-largest Indian IT company by 2020 revenue figures and the 602nd largest public company in the world according to Forbes Global 2000 ranking. The company helps enterprises navigate their digital transformation with an AI-first approach, empowering businesses with agile digital at scale and driving continuous improvement with always-on learning through their digital skills platform.

Where is Infosys's Headquarters?

HQ Function

Serves as the central hub for global operations, strategic decision-making, research and development, corporate functions, and houses its renowned training facilities.

Notable Features:

The Infosys Bengaluru campus is renowned for its vast size (over 80 acres), eco-friendly design, state-of-the-art training facilities (including the Global Education Center which is one of the world's largest corporate universities), recreational amenities like swimming pools and theaters, iconic pyramid-like structures, a large geodesic dome, one of the world's largest cantilevered roofs, and extensive use of solar power.

Work Culture:

Infosys's HQ fosters a culture of continuous learning, innovation, and collaboration. It's known for its rigorous training programs and emphasis on employee development. The campus environment is designed to support work-life balance with numerous amenities, though work can be demanding given the nature of the IT services industry. The culture emphasizes respect, integrity, and customer-centricity.

HQ Significance:

The Bengaluru HQ is a symbol of India's IT prowess and Infosys's journey from a small startup to a global tech giant. It's a significant landmark in 'India's Silicon Valley' and a major employment center, often visited by global dignitaries.

Values Reflected in HQ: The campus design and operations reflect Infosys's values of sustainability (C-LIFE: Climate, Living, Inclusivity, Food, Energy), continuous learning, employee well-being, and technological excellence.

Executive Team of Infosys

As of April 2025, Infosys' leadership includes:

Salil Parekh - Chief Executive Officer and Managing Director
Jayesh Sanghrajka - Chief Financial Officer
Inderpreet Sawhney - Group General Counsel and Chief Compliance Officer
Shaji Mathew - Group Head of Human Resources
Martha S. King - Chief Client Officer, EVP
Sunil Kumar Dhareshwar - EVP & Group Head Finance

News and media

Infosys InvestorsApril 18, 2024

Infosys Q4 and FY24 Results: Net Profit Rises, FY25 Revenue Growth Guided at 1-3%

Infosys reported its financial results for the fourth quarter and full fiscal year 2024. For Q4 FY24, net profit rose 30% YoY to ₹7,969 crore. Revenue from operations was ₹37,923 crore. The company guided for a 1%-3% revenue growth in constant currency and an operating margin of 20%-22% for FY25....more
